Question Analysis
This question assesses the student's understanding of the First Derivative Test, specifically how the sign change of the first derivative around a critical point determines whether it is a relative minimum.
Key Concept Explanation
The First Derivative Test states that if the first derivative changes from negative to positive at a critical point, then the function has a relative minimum at that point.
